I need to polish the aluminum wheels on my truck. I've used the mothers power ball mini before but I need something with some more speed behind it. Is there a "local "store I can get these from?

You don't want to use a grinder (wrong speed) for polishing. You want to get a polisher (mine looks like a die grinder) that runs at lower speed.

Harbor freight polisher works just fine, but the pads it comes with are junk.

A drill with an adapter will work OK as a polisher.

I would NOT use a grinder. It will be an awful experience and you'll probably ruin your pad and/or your wheels. I've tried it before, its very difficult.
